Carol Brock, Clip 2: Fine Dining at the 1964 World's Fair

Description: Carol Brock discusses the 1964 World's Fair and its effect on fine dining in New York City. She recalls that the director of the Fair's Spanish dining facility stayed in New York and opened a successful Spanish restaurant in Bayside, which still exists today as Marbella.
